Janae’s Inside Report: Muskegon Correctional Facility (8/22/15)

On August 22, 2015, we had a great opportunity to share with the men again at Muskegon Correctional Facility. We had been there in May of this year and many of the guys had stated that we should come back in August to do an outdoor concert. They mentioned that because the weather was so nice, and the fact that the guys are inside the majority of the time, it would be nice to be outdoors rather than inside for a concert.

One week before the outdoor concert was scheduled, there were some disturbances that forced the administration to change the venue to indoors. So, we could either reschedule, or have the concert indoors again. Many of the guys had their hearts set on the concert so we went ahead with it on the date promised.

It was a tremendous time in the Lord. Fifteen members of the Calvary Church Choir came and opened the evening. What a powerful time…the men stood to praise God as the Choir sang.  It was the first time in a prison for many of the Choir members. They were certainly blessed by having come. Our dear friend Ren Broekhuizen spoke from the word of God with a message titled, “This is the man: Jesus.” He is an amazing communicator and this day was no different. The men cheered, stood, and clapped for our Lord as he shared. As Wayburn sang, many were moved to tears, praising God…standing again and giving Him praise. There were approximately 120 guys in attendance as two men gave their lives to Christ this evening. A beautiful time in the Lord. We will go back at Christmas time. The men requested the Choir again.
